From a1574db108943e97395f85caf2a47e87599a1491 Mon Sep 17 00:00:00 2001 From: plodah Date: Sun, 1 Dec 2024 15:54:22 +0000 Subject: [PATCH] add msjig to iris --- keyboards/keebio/iris/keymaps/plodahc/config.h | 6 ++++++ keyboards/keebio/iris/keymaps/plodahc/keymap.c | 3 ++- keyboards/keebio/iris/keymaps/plodahc/rules.mk | 2 +- 3 files changed, 9 insertions(+), 2 deletions(-) diff --git a/keyboards/keebio/iris/keymaps/plodahc/config.h b/keyboards/keebio/iris/keymaps/plodahc/config.h index a232ba47f0..64ed501e0b 100644 --- a/keyboards/keebio/iris/keymaps/plodahc/config.h +++ b/keyboards/keebio/iris/keymaps/plodahc/config.h @@ -12,6 +12,12 @@ #define PLODAH_BORING_LAYER 1 +#if defined(DEFERRED_EXEC_ENABLE) + #define PLODAH_MSJIGGLER_ENABLED + #define PLODAH_MSJIGGLER_INTRO + // #define PLODAH_MSJIGGLER_INTRO_TIMEOUT 1200 +#endif // DEFERRED_EXEC_ENABLE + #if defined(TAP_DANCE_ENABLE) #define PLODAH_TAPDANCE_TAPHOLD_ENABLE #endif // TAP_DANCE_ENABLE diff --git a/keyboards/keebio/iris/keymaps/plodahc/keymap.c b/keyboards/keebio/iris/keymaps/plodahc/keymap.c index 6adfc5931e..a7d1fbef57 100644 --- a/keyboards/keebio/iris/keymaps/plodahc/keymap.c +++ b/keyboards/keebio/iris/keymaps/plodahc/keymap.c @@ -3,6 +3,7 @@ enum keymap_keycodes { PL_ALTTAB = QK_USER_0, PL_ALTSTAB, + PL_MSJG, PL_QFTR, PL_QRGB, PL_QVER, @@ -42,7 +43,7 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= { P_ENTAL, P_ENTM3, P_SPCM2, P_SPCM2, P_ENTM3, P_ENALG ), [2] = LAYOUT( - KC_GRV, _______, _______, PL_QFTR, PL_QRGB, QK_MAKE, QK_MAKE, PL_QVER, _______, KC_MINS, KC_EQL, KC_DEL, + KC_GRV, _______, _______, PL_QFTR, PL_QRGB, QK_MAKE, QK_MAKE, PL_QVER, PL_MSJG, KC_MINS, KC_EQL, KC_DEL, _______, _______, KC_UP, _______, _______, _______, _______, _______, _______, KC_UP, _______, KC_RBRC, _______, KC_LEFT, KC_DOWN, KC_RGHT, _______, KC_LBRC, KC_RBRC, _______, KC_LEFT, KC_DOWN, KC_RGHT, KC_NUHS, _______, KC_NUBS, _______, _______, _______, KC_RCBR, XXXXXXX, XXXXXXX, KC_RCBR, _______, _______, _______, _______, _______, diff --git a/keyboards/keebio/iris/keymaps/plodahc/rules.mk b/keyboards/keebio/iris/keymaps/plodahc/rules.mk index 3bfe35476d..cd2619c8dd 100644 --- a/keyboards/keebio/iris/keymaps/plodahc/rules.mk +++ b/keyboards/keebio/iris/keymaps/plodahc/rules.mk @@ -7,7 +7,7 @@ BOOTMAGIC_ENABLE = yes CAPS_WORD_ENABLE = yes COMBO_ENABLE = yes CONSOLE_ENABLE = no -DEFERRED_EXEC_ENABLE = no +DEFERRED_EXEC_ENABLE = yes DYNAMIC_MACRO_ENABLE = yes DYNAMIC_TAPPING_TERM_ENABLE = no ENCODER_MAP_ENABLE = no